In this chapter, God told Jeremiah that some hard days were coming for the people. But God also tucked a beautiful promise inside — a promise about coming home.

Today's Story

God gave Jeremiah a hard message. He had to tell the people that, because they kept turning away, a sad time was coming. One day they would have to leave their homes and live far away in another land for a while.

That is a hard thing to hear. But God did not stop there. He never leaves His people without hope.

God made a wonderful promise. He said, “The day is coming when I will bring My people back. I will gather them from every far-away place and lead them home again to the good land I gave them.”

Even when things looked sad, God was already planning the happy ending. He is like a shepherd who will go anywhere to bring his sheep home. No matter how far away you feel, God always knows the way to bring you back to Him.

Talk About It

  1. Even with a hard message, God added a promise about bringing people home. Why do you think God always gives us hope?
  2. Have you ever been away from home and felt happy to come back? How does it feel when you walk back through your own door?
  3. God promised to gather His people from far away. What does it tell you about God that He never gives up on bringing us back to Him?
